In spite islamic calendar can be considered uncertain, according to links reported here, the current code in SaudiArabia.java has suspicious code which tests only 2004 and 2005.
The code must be changed according to reliable official sources of information.

I've done some cosmetic changes in order to make it look like other calendars.
This class needs a complete code review, specially because Islamic calendar is absolutely uncertain. Holidays are determined by visual observation of natural events, like the full moon after another uncertain holiday. The visual observation can be affected by a cloudy weather and it changes the outcome of it.
For this reason, past years must be verified against some reliable source.
Current and future years need to be reviewed.
